Benefits of Having a Treadmill at Home

A treadmill at home can help to eliminate barriers that might otherwise prevent you from getting the exercise you need. This could include working out at home, travelling to a gym or overcoming bad weather conditions.

Treadmills are also great for building muscle. You can adjust the incline to target different muscles throughout your body.

It's Convenient

A treadmill at home allows you to exercise whenever it's convenient for you without having to worry about getting to the gym or dealing with the weather being unpredictable. This is particularly useful when you have children who are small or a busy schedule that prevents your going to the gym.

If losing weight and/or getting into shape are your main objectives the treadmill is a great option because it is an exercise that has low impact and is well tolerated by most people, regardless of their fitness level. As you build strength and endurance you can move to walking. If back pain is a major concern most treadmills have an ergonomic cushioning system to reduce the impact on joints.

The majority of treadmills offer a variety of workout programs that you can choose from. Some treadmills have virtual locations that transport you to beaches and mountains around the world. This will prevent you from becoming bored by your exercise routine. You can adjust the surface of your machine to make it stronger or soft based on how your ankles and knees feel after exercise.

You can choose treadmills with a 22-inch touchscreen that has a high-definition display. This will show you all your exercise data including time, distance and calories burned. More affordable treadmills may have smaller screens or require you to press buttons to access this information, but high-end models typically display all of the important information on one screen.

Before you buy a treadmill, make sure you measure your space and look for one that folds up when not in use. Some treadmills can be stowed under furniture, so you don't need to fret about taking up precious floor space.

Another thing to be aware of is how many inclined settings you require, as this can be a significant factor in your exercise. If you reside in an area that is hilly such as a hilly area you'll need a treadmill that can replicate the steep slopes you're used to. Also, you'll want ensure that the treadmill is equipped with a high-quality motor and can handle your weight. Also, you should think about how much space you have in your house or apartment and whether you need a compact model that folds to save space.

Treadmills can be programmed, which means you can customize them to your own fitness level. No matter if you're just beginning out or you're an experienced runner who wants an intense workout, you can adjust the speed and incline to meet your requirements. This can also help to avoid boredom as your body won't be used to the same routine. Some treadmills have race simulation software that can assist you in preparing for your next big race.



Treadmills are not only great to customize your workout, but also to increase the size of your muscles. You can build leg muscles by increasing the resistance in your workout by using the function of incline. This type of exercise could be helpful for those trying to lose weight, since it can boost your metabolism and make your body burn fat more quickly.

Treadmills can also be utilized to improve bone density. Numerous studies have shown that running, jogging or walking on a treadmill improves bone density. This is because these types of exercises can make your bones stronger, which can lower your risk of developing osteoporosis later on in the course of your.

Think about the features you would like most in a treadmill prior to you purchase one. Do you see yourself relaxing on a stroll, running hard or somewhere in between? Your answer will help you narrow down your treadmill options based on speed, incline settings and much more. For instance, if you intend to run, search for a treadmill with a longer track and a more powerful motor to handle high-intensity exercises.

When you are buying a treadmill you must also think about your budget and the space you have. Do you have a lot of floor space to accommodate an enormous treadmill, or do you want to keep the machine folded away when it is not in use? Certain treadmills can be folded in half by pressing a button. This will save space when you're not making use of them. Other machines feature wheels to make it easy to transfer the treadmill to other areas of your home when required. Don't forget to look into warranties prior to making your purchase. A warranty is a good indication of the quality and durability of a treadmill, therefore it's worth the cost to purchase a treadmill that comes with a great warranty.
